Maria Ximena Senatore is a National Researcher at CONICET (National Council of Scientific and Technological Research), Argentina, Professor on Historical Archaeology and Heritage at the University of Buenos Aires and at the National University of Patagonia Austral. She has a degree in Archaeology (University of Buenos Aires, 1995) and PhD in History (2003, University of Valladolid, Spain). Maria Ximena has been running research projects on the Archaeology of Capitalism Expansion to Antarctica in the 19th century, Materialities of Antarctic History, and Master Narratives, Heritage Conservation and Tourism in Antarctica.

  • Research projects / interests:
    • Historical Archaeology and Material Culture Studies
    • Capitalism expansion to Antarctica, whaling and sealing in 19th century
    • History of Antarctica and Master Narratives
    • Materialities of Antarctic History
    • Polar Cultural Heritage
    • Antarctic Tourism focused on the History of Exploration
    • Museums and uses of cultural heritage
    • Use of ship logbooks, historical cartography and, diaries as a data source for Antarctic History Studies
    • Human Interactions with Antarctica
